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
97567 983827 90279 81 62832169866
0476368906 997049586 99335691021
0476368906 997049586 99335691021
0992 7699714410 63585
All about undefined
Interested in learning more?
0476368906 997049586 99335691021
0992 7699714410 63585
See more
597 29126714 36612409
803 8990899557 42
See more
615714341 8436 98
2613026932 28797886 629012 71646088
See more